Gilberto Ramirez vs David Benavidez Prediction
The cruiserweight title clash between Gilberto Ramirez and David Benavidez is a highly anticipated 'Mexico vs. Mexico' showdown. Ramirez, the unified WBA and WBO champion, faces a significant challenge in the undefeated and aggressive David Benavidez, who is moving up in weight. Benavidez's relentless pressure and power are expected to be key, while Ramirez's recent shoulder surgery and layoff add an element of uncertainty to his performance.
